SAT notes September 4, 2014 part 2


  • they day before the SAT dont do practice tests 
  • Do look over all the tactics listed below so they will be fresh in your mind 
  • Set out your test kit the night before 
  • first answer all the easy questions 
  • change answers only if you have a reason to do so 
  • in double blank sentences test one blank at a time not two 
  • read all answer choices before you decide which is best 
  • a word may have more than one meaning 
  • before you look at the choices think of a word that makes sense 
  • read as rapidly as you can with understanding 
  • as you read opening sentences try to predict what the passage is about 
  • base your answer only on what is written in the passage 
  • try to answer all the questions on a particular passage 
  • whenever you know how to answer a question directly do it 
  • no lengthy arithmetic
  • the answer to a grid in question can never be negative 
  • you can never grid in a mixed number 
  • when girding a decimal point never put a 0 in front 
  • there is no penalty for wrong answers on grid ins
